Please email …The Wasserman Center Internship Grant was established to provide financial assistance to students pursuing unpaid internships in qualifying industries that do not traditionally pay their interns. The Wasserman Center offers $1,200 grants during the fall and spring semesters, and $2,000 grants during the summer. ... Networking is a process through which we develop and maintain relationships with professionals in order to solicit information, advice and referrals that will facilitate the job search. It will be one of your most valuable job search tools.
